2023-24 Final Standings

1. Wisconsin Lutheran 12-0 (30-0); 2. Pewaukee 10-2 (25-5); 3. Pius XI Catholic 7-5 (17-9); 4. West Allis Central 5-7 (16-12); 5. New Berlin Eisenhower 4-8 (11-14); 6. New Berlin West 3-9 (13-13); 7. Greendale 1-11 (9-15).

2024-25 Picks

1. West Allis Central -- The Bulldogs hope to upset the apple cart a bit in the Woodland West this winter. The goal of coach Dave Mlachnik's squad most definitely is to knock Wisconsin Lutheran and Pewaukee off the top of the league standings, a place both schools have held for a long time. The firepower to do so is certainly there are all five starters return from a 16-12 squad. Leading the way are a pair of players with NCAA Division I scholarship offers in juniors Yusef Gray Jr. Yusef Gray Jr. Yusef Gray Jr. 6'4" | SG West Allis Central | 2026 State WI (6-5, 19.6 ppg, 6.3 rpg) and Kevin Pittman Kevin Pittman Kevin Pittman 6'10" | PF West Allis Central | 2026 State WI (6-10, 9.4 ppg, 8.8 rpg). Gray missed the majority of last season with an injury, but played well over the spring/summer on the club circuit and earned offers from Creighton, De Paul and Iowa State, among others. Pittman continues to take big strides in his game, losing weight and becoming more of an offensive threat. He recently picked up an offer from Western Michigan. Sophomore Max Jones Max Jones Max Jones 6'4" | SG West Allis Central | 2027 State WI (6-3, 15.5 ppg, 5.7 rpg) is one of the state's better class of 2027 prospects while senior Ewell Clinton Jr. Ewell Clinton Jr. 6'3" | SF West Allis Central | 2025 State WI (6-2, 9.9 ppg, 3.3 rpg) and junior Kayden Travis (5-7, 8.4 ppg, 3.0 rpg) also return. Depth will be provided by sophomores Isaiah Fox Isaiah Fox Isaiah Fox 6'0" | PG West Allis Central | 2027 State WI (6-0, 7.5 ppg, 3.6 rpg) and Caiden Davis Caiden Davis Caiden Davis 6'3" | SF West Allis Central | 2027 State WI (6-2, 3.3 ppg, 2.6 rpg) along with junior Marcues Lovy (6-0).

2. Wisconsin Lutheran -- The loss of one of Wisconsin's all-time great high school players, Kon Knueppel (6-6, 25.9 ppg, 8.6 rpg, now playing at Duke), will be difficult to overcome for coach Ryan Walz, but three starters and some eager newcomers hope to keep the Vikings atop in the Woodland West. Seniors Isaiah Mellock Isaiah Mellock Isaiah Mellock 6'1" | CG Wisconsin Lutheran | 2025 State WI (6-1, 8.6 ppg, 4.6 rpg) and Alex Greene Alex Greene Alex Greene 6'4" | SF Wisconsin Lutheran | 2025 State WI (6-3, 7.6 ppg, 2.9 rpg) along with junior Zavier Zens Zavier Zens Zavier Zens 6'7" | SF Wisconsin Lutheran | 2026 State WI (6-6, 9.9 ppg, 4.7 rpg) are back to provide great leadership in addition to their production. Seniors Nick Cross (6-3), Ben Langebartels (6-7) and Josiah Rice (6-0) along with sophomore Kager Knueppel Kager Knueppel Kager Knueppel 6'9" | SF/SG Wisconsin Lutheran | 2027 State #112 Nation WI (6-6) saw action off the bench for the WIAA Division 2 state champions and figure to take on bigger roles in 2024-25.

3. Pewaukee -- It's not overly wise to project one of the state's elite programs to finish third in its own division, but that is the case, at least in the preseason, for Pewaukee in 2024-25. The Pirates' streak of three straight WIAA Division 2 state titles was snapped by league-rival Wisconsin Lutheran last March, and coach David Burkemper must replace the school's all-time leading scorer in Nick Janowski (6-3, 30.8 ppg, 8.2 rpg, now playing at Nebraska). At the same time, Burkemper welcomes back three stellar performers off last year's 25-5 squad in seniors Luka Momcilovic Luka Momcilovic Luka Momcilovic 6'8" | PF Pewaukee | 2025 State WI (6-8, 12.3 ppg, 6.7 rpg, committed to St. Thomas), Karson Osterman Karson Osterman Karson Osterman 5'9" | PG Pewaukee | 2025 State WI (5-9, 6.4 ppg, 2.9 rpg, committed to Superior) and Isaiah Robinson Isaiah Robinson Isaiah Robinson 6'1" | PG Pewaukee | 2025 State WI (6-1, 5.7 ppg, 2.5 rpg). That gifted trio will get plenty of help from juniors Tyler Tiutczenko Tyler Tiutczenko Tyler Tiutczenko 6'8" | PF Pewaukee | 2026 State WI (6-6, 7.4 ppg, 2.7 rpg), George Davis George Davis 6'3" | SF/SG Pewaukee | 2026 State WI (6-4, 1.6 ppg) and Landon Stelse Landon Stelse Landon Stelse 6'2" | SG/PG Pewaukee | 2026 WI (6-0) along with sophomores John Gerdes (6-3) and Jonah Schaefer Jonah Schaefer Jonah Schaefer 6'1" | SG/PG Pewaukee | 2027 State WI (5-11).

4. New Berlin West -- With three double-figure scorers back along with some talented newcomers from a 14-8 JV1 squad, New Berlin West is aiming to get over the .500 mark after finishing 13-13 last winter. Coach Scott Cook again will count on the terrific perimeter shooting of his son, sophomore Jayce Cook Jayce Cook Jayce Cook 6'1" | SG New Berlin West | 2027 State WI (6-1, 16.5 ppg, 3.0 rpg), as a go-to option on offense. But the Vikings have others who can score as well in senior Josh Krier Josh Krier Josh Krier 6'3" | PG New Berlin West | 2025 State WI (6-3, 11.5 ppg, 5.0 rpg) and junior Evan Kern Evan Kern Evan Kern 6'2" | SG New Berlin West | 2026 State WI (6-3, 14.5 ppg, 5.0 rpg). Senior Thomas Moe Thomas Moe 6'4" | SG New Berlin West | 2025 WI (6-4, 6.3 ppg, 4.1 rpg) is the fourth returning regular at New Berlin West. Others who should make their way into the regular playing rotation include senior Ben Thompson (6-2, 4.0 ppg), junior Luke Krueger (6-1, 4.7 ppg), junior Elijah Gammage (6-2, 2.6 ppg, 2.6 rpg) and sophomore Zach Hewitt Zach Hewitt 6'4" | SF New Berlin West | 2027 State WI (6-4, 5.6 ppg, 3.0 rpg).

5. New Berlin Eisenhower -- The Lions have a new coach in Austin Stueck, a former standout player at South Milwaukee and Milwaukee School of Engineering. Stueck takes over the New Berlin Eisenhower program at a good time as there is good talent returning and good talent forthcoming in the future. Three players who started on last year's 11-14 squad return in senior Kevin Kreitzer Kevin Kreitzer 5'10" | CG New Berlin Eisenhower | 2025 WI (5-10, 9.5 ppg) and juniors Chris Nimmer (5-10, 6.4 ppg, 2.7 rpg) and Jake Veley Jake Veley Jake Veley 6'3" | SF New Berlin Eisenhower | 2026 State WI (6-3, 11.2 ppg, 7.7 rpg). That threesome will play pivotal roles for the Lions, who also welcome back Thaison Martin Thaison Martin Thaison Martin 5'7" | PG New Berlin Eisenhower | 2026 WI (5-8), Mavox Nimani Mavox Nimani 6'4" | SF New Berlin Eisenhower | 2026 State WI (6-3), Connor Carlson (6-7) and Max Nemoir (5-11). Expect freshman Will Kowske Will Kowske Will Kowske 6'4" | SF/SG New Berlin Eisenhower | 2028 State WI (6-4), the son of former Dominican and University of Wisconsin forward Andy Kowske, to also make a contribution.

6. Greendale
-- Led by the return of senior Devin Isaj Devin Isaj Devin Isaj 6'6" | SF/SG Greendale | 2025 State WI (6-6, 23.3 ppg, 5.8 rpg), Greendale hopes to improve on last year's 9-15 record. Isaj is a four-year varsity performer who can fill up the basket with the best of them. His production, versatility and leadership will be assets for the Panthers. Joining Isaj as returning starters for veteran coach Ryan Johnsen are seniors Luke Mattes Luke Mattes 6'5" | SF Greendale | 2025 WI (6-5, 9.5 ppg, 5.2 rpg) and Landon Lopez (6-6, 6.2 ppg, 4.8 rpg) along with juniors Zavier Castillo Zavier Castillo Zavier Castillo 6'4" | SG Greendale | 2026 State WI (6-3, 7.2 ppg, 3.7 rpg) and Brandon Harper (6-1, 7.0 ppg, 3.6 rpg). Experience, size and scoring balance are strengths.

7. Pius XI Catholic -- The Popes will start over again after finishing 17-9 a year ago and losing five key players to graduation. Gone from that squad, among others, are Jaquan Johnson (5-10, 32.3 ppg, 7.6 rpg, now playing at Bradley), Julian Alvarez Robles (5-10, 14.2 ppg, 2.7 rpg) and Cai Joseph (6-1, 11.6 ppg, 6.9 rpg, now playing at Carroll). Coach Dan Carey will go with a youth movement in 2024-25 as several freshmen and sophomores will play key roles. Senior Jeremiah Fitzgerald (6-2) and juniors Jayson Kowalski Jayson Kowalski Jayson Kowalski 6'2" | SG Pius XI Catholic | 2026 State WI (6-1, 7.0 ppg) and DeAndre Haynes Jr. (5-10) will provide upperclass support for the likes of sophomores Justin Jones Justin Jones Justin Jones 5'9" | PG Pius XI Catholic | 2027 State WI (5-9), Preston Kirchoff Preston Kirchoff Preston Kirchoff 5'9" | PG Pius XI Catholic | 2027 WI (5-9), Jordan Blockton Jordan Blockton Jordan Blockton 6'2" | PG/CG Martin Luther | 2027 State WI (5-9), Nasir Nelson Nasir Nelson Nasir Nelson 5'11" | CG Pius XI Catholic | 2027 WI (6-0) and Torrence Rivera Torrence Rivera Torrence Rivera 6'2" | SG Pius XI | 2027 State WI (6-2). Freshmen Emmett Munson Emmett Munson Emmett Munson 6'4" | SF Burlington | 2028 State WI (6-3) and Vinnie Walker Vinnie Walker Vinnie Walker 5'9" | CG Brookfield Central | 2028 WI (5-9) also figure to play big roles for the Popes.
